Output ee173504a0b68b776193d8209837ca718850427daa9df89a2021fffe87375010:2

value
174106
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7e37cf621d14ec451e72545570ca909d07158f90 OP_EQUALVERIFY OP_CHECKSIG
address
1CWNzvaR6V2d5dwTGRCmpHHPbE2hYM5F2C
transaction
ee173504a0b68b776193d8209837ca718850427daa9df89a2021fffe87375010
confirmations
556799
spent
true